Зачем может понадобиться Excel в формате изображения?
Представьте ситуацию: вам нужно вставить таблицу из Microsoft Excel в презентацию PowerPoint, документ Word или отправить коллеге, у которого нет доступа к Excel. Или, например, опубликовать отчёт в соцсетях, где поддерживаются только графические файлы. В таких случаях конвертация таблицы в изображение становится единственным решением.
Но здесь возникает логичный вопрос: как сделать это правильно, чтобы не потерять качество, сохранить читаемость мелкого текста и избежать искажений? В этой статье мы разберём 5 проверенных способов — от встроенных функций Excel до специализированных онлайн-сервисов. Каждый метод подходит для разных задач: где-то важна скорость, где-то — максимальное качество, а где-то — возможность редактировать результат.
Особое внимание уделим скрытым настройкам экспорта в Excel 2019 и новее, которые позволяют сохранять таблицы в формате SVG — векторном формате, идеальном для масштабирования без потери качества. Это актуально для полиграфии, веб-дизайна и профессиональных отчётов.
Способ 1: Копирование как картинка через буфер обмена (самый быстрый)
Если вам нужно срочно вставить таблицу в другой документ, этот метод сэкономит время. Он работает во всех версиях Excel (начиная с 2007) и не требует установки дополнительных программ.
Алгоритм прост:
- 📋 Выделите диапазон ячеек, который хотите преобразовать в изображение (например,
A1:D10). - 🖱️ Нажмите правой кнопкой мыши на выделенную область и выберите
Копировать как → Картинка. - 🖼️ В открывшемся окне выберите формат:
- Как на экране — сохраняет текущий вид (включая фильтры и условное форматирование).
- Как на печати — имитирует вид при печати (убирает сетку, если она отключена в настройках).
- 📎 Вставьте картинку в целевой документ через
Ctrl+Vили контекстное меню.
⚠️ Внимание: При копировании больших таблиц (более 50×50 ячеек) изображение может получиться размытым. В таких случаях лучше использовать Способ 3 (экспорт в PDF с последующим преобразованием).
Способ 2: Сохранение листа Excel как веб-страницы (для высокого качества)
Этот метод подходит, если вам нужно получить изображение с максимальным разрешением, например, для печати плакатов или баннеров. Он использует промежуточный формат HTML, который затем конвертируется в графический файл.
Инструкция:
- Откройте файл в Excel и перейдите в
Файл → Сохранить как. - В поле
Тип файлавыберитеВеб-страница (.htm; .html). - Нажмите
Сохранить. Excel создаст папку сHTML-файлом и вложенными изображениями. - Откройте сгенерированную папку (она будет иметь то же имя, что и ваш файл, но с суффиксом
_files). - Найдите файлы с расширением
.pngили.gif— это и есть ваши таблицы в виде картинок.
Преимущества метода:
- 🔍 Сохраняет все форматы (цвета, шрифты, границы).
- 📏 Поддерживает большие таблицы (до 1000×1000 ячеек).
- 🖼️ Картинки получаются в высоком разрешении (до 300 dpi).
Что делать, если в папке нет изображений?
Если после сохранения веб-страницы в папке _files нет графических файлов, проверьте:
1. В вашей таблице есть данные (пустые листы не экспортируются).
2. В настройках Excel не отключён экспорт графики (перейдите в Файл → Параметры → Дополнительно → Веб-параметры и убедитесь, что галочка Сохранять рисунки стоит).
3. Попробуйте сохранить файл в формате Веб-страница (один файл) (*.mht) — иногда это решает проблему.
Способ 3: Экспорт в PDF с последующей конвертацией в изображение
Один из самых универсальных способов, который работает даже на Mac и в Excel Online. Суть в том, чтобы сначала сохранить таблицу в PDF, а затем преобразовать PDF в изображение с помощью бесплатных инструментов.
Пошаговая инструкция:
- В Excel нажмите
Файл → Экспорт → Создать PDF/XPS. - Выберите папку для сохранения и нажмите
Опубликовать. - Откройте полученный
PDF-файл в программе Adobe Acrobat Reader или онлайн-сервисе (например, iLovePDF). - Экспортируйте страницы
PDFвJPG,PNGилиSVG.
🔹 Совет: Если вам нужно изображение только части таблицы, перед экспортом в PDF установите Область печати (Разметка страницы → Область печати → Задать). Это позволит избежать лишних пустых областей на картинке.
| Формат | Плюсы | Минусы | Рекомендация |
|---|---|---|---|
PNG |
Без потерь качества, поддерживает прозрачность | Большой размер файла | Для веб и презентаций |
JPG |
Маленький размер, подходит для фото | Потери качества при сжатии | Для печати с текстом не подходит |
SVG |
Векторный формат, масштабируется без потерь | Не все программы поддерживают | Для логотипов и схем |
GIF |
Поддерживает анимацию | Ограниченная палитра цветов | Для простых диаграмм |
Способ 4: Использование надстройки "Снимок экрана" в Windows 10/11
Если вам нужно быстро сделать скриншот таблицы без сохранения файла, воспользуйтесь встроенным инструментом Windows — Ножницы (Snipping Tool) или комбинацией клавиш Win + Shift + S.
Как это работает:
- 🖥️ Откройте файл Excel и расположите окно так, чтобы таблица полностью помещалась на экране.
- 🔳 Нажмите
Win + Shift + S— экран потемнеет, а курсор превратится в крестик. - 📐 Выделите мышкой область таблицы, которую хотите сохранить.
- 💾 Скриншот автоматически скопируется в буфер обмена. Вставьте его в Paint или другой редактор и сохраните как
PNG.
⚠️ Внимание: При таком способе качество изображения зависит от разрешения вашего экрана. На мониторах с разрешением Full HD (1920×1080) текст будет чётким, но на 4K-дисплеях могут появиться артефакты при масштабировании.
Увеличить масштаб отображения до 100-150%|Убрать лишние панели инструментов|Отключить сетку (если не нужна)|Прокрутить таблицу так, чтобы видно было все данные-->
Способ 5: Онлайн-сервисы для конвертации Excel в изображение
Если у вас нет доступа к Excel или нужно обработать файл на смартфоне, воспользуйтесь онлайн-конвертерами. Они поддерживают форматы XLSX, XLS, CSV и позволяют выбрать разрешений выходного изображения.
Топ-3 проверенных сервиса:
- 🌐 Zamzar — поддерживает
PNG,JPG,GIF, бесплатно до 50 МБ. - 🌐 CloudConvert — можно настроить
DPIи качество сжатия. - 🌐 AConvert — позволяет конвертировать сразу несколько листов.
🔹 Важно: Перед загрузкой файлов на онлайн-сервисы убедитесь, что в них нет конфиденциальных данных. Большинство платформ удаляют файлы через 1-2 часа, но риск утечки информации остаётся.
Сравнение способов: какой выбрать?
Выбор метода зависит от вашей задачи. Вот краткое резюме:
- 🚀 Максимальная скорость: Копирование как картинка (Способ 1) или скриншот (Способ 4).
- 🎨 Лучшее качество: Экспорт в
PDF(Способ 3) или сохранение как веб-страницу (Способ 2). - 🌍 Для онлайн-работы: Сервисы из Способа 5.
- 📊 Для больших таблиц: Веб-страница (Способ 2) или
PDF(Способ 3).
Если вы часто конвертируете таблицы, рекомендуем создать макрос в Excel, который будет автоматически сохранять выделенный диапазон в PNG. Пример кода для VBA:
Sub SaveAsPicture()
Dim rng As Range
Set rng = Selection
rng.CopyPicture Appearance:=xlScreen, Format:=xlPicture
With ThisWorkbook
.Sheets.Add After:=.Sheets(.Sheets.Count)
.Sheets(.Sheets.Count).Paste
.Sheets(.Sheets.Count).ExportAsFixedFormat _
Type:=xlTypePNG, _
Filename:="C:\Temp\ExcelPicture.png", _
Quality:=xlQualityMinimum
.Sheets(.Sheets.Count).Delete
End With
End Sub
Этот макрос сохраняет выделенную область как PNG в папку C:\Temp. Вы можете изменить путь и формат по своему усмотрению.
FAQ: Частые вопросы о конвертации Excel в изображение
Можно ли сохранить только диаграмму из Excel как картинку?
Да! Кликните правой кнопкой по диаграмме и выберите Сохранить как рисунок. В Excel 2016 и новее доступны форматы PNG, JPG, GIF и EMF (векторный).
Почему при копировании как картинка пропадают некоторые данные?
Это происходит, если:
- Включён фильтр (скрытые строки/столбцы не копируются).
- Выделенная область выходит за пределы печатаемой зоны (проверьте
Область печати). - В ячейках используются объединённые области — иногда они отображаются некорректно.
Решение: перед копированием снимите все фильтры и проверьте видимость данных.
Как сохранить таблицу Excel в SVG для веб-сайта?
В Excel 2019 и Microsoft 365:
- Выделите таблицу.
- Нажмите
Файл → Экспорт → Изменить тип файла → SVG. - Настройте параметры (например,
Включить фон) и сохраните.
В старых версиях: сначала экспортируйте в PDF, затем конвертируйте PDF в SVG через Inkscape или Convertio.
Можно ли автоматизировать конвертацию для сотен файлов?
Да, с помощью Power Query или VBA. Пример скрипта для пакетной обработки:
Sub BatchConvertToPNG()
Dim wb As Workbook
Dim ws As Worksheet
Dim folderPath As String
folderPath = "C:\YourFolder\" ' Укажите путь к папке с файлами
ChDir folderPath
file = Dir("*.xlsx")
Do While file <> ""
Set wb = Workbooks.Open(folderPath & file)
For Each ws In wb.Worksheets
ws.UsedRange.CopyPicture Appearance:=xlScreen, Format:=xlPicture
With wb
.Sheets.Add After:=.Sheets(.Sheets.Count)
.Sheets(.Sheets.Count).Paste
.Sheets(.Sheets.Count).ExportAsFixedFormat _
Type:=xlTypePNG, _
Filename:=folderPath & Replace(file, ".xlsx", "") & "_" & ws.Name & ".png", _
Quality:=xlQualityStandard
.Sheets(.Sheets.Count).Delete
End With
Next ws
wb.Close SaveChanges:=False
file = Dir
Loop
End Sub
Скрипт обрабатывает все .xlsx-файлы в указанной папке и сохраняет каждый лист как отдельное изображение.
Почему в онлайн-конвертерах таблица получается размытой?
Причины:
- Сервис автоматически уменьшает разрешение для экономии места.
- Исходный файл Excel содержит слишком мелкий текст (менее 10 pt).
- Формат выходного файла —
JPG(попробуйтеPNG).
Решение: перед конвертацией увеличьте шрифт в Excel или выберите сервис с настройками DPI (например, CloudConvert).